Maybe someone has crossed this bridge before and I don’t have to do it again. I have a 2004 S60, I am interested in replacing the factory stereo with an aftermarket one. Chutchfield says they have no information on Volvos. I a looking at purchasing a double DIN DVD unit, but I don’t want to lose the function of my Volvo GPS and my stereo controls on the steering wheel. I like my toys in the car I want my Zune to plug in, have Sirius built in and Bluetooth. Any recommendation, wiring kits, and install kits let me know.

I don't know if you found a solution, but I just purchased a Pioneer Avic f900bt. This thing looked like the answer to me. I have done copious research on the deck and decided to go ahead and make the purchase.

I have a 2004 S60 R. I wanted something that would play my Sirius XM subscription, DVDs, CDs, my iPod, and GPS. Well, the Avic did me much better. It pairs with your phone (via bluetooth) when you're in the car and is a handsfree phone system with tons of neat features (eg. Goog-411, etc) built in.

it works seamlessly with your ipod and boasts full functional control. It's a pretty sweet toy.

I found a double din replacement piece for my console at MySwedishParts.com
Part no. 8684591
